what is a troll? what is a kill file?


1. v.,n. [From the Usenet group alt.folklore.urban] To utter a posting on
Usenet designed to attract predictable responses or flames; or, the post
itself. Derives from the phrase "trolling for newbies" which in turn comes
from mainstream "trolling", a style of fishing in which one trails bait
through a likely spot hoping for a bite. The well-constructed troll is a
post that induces lots of newbies and flamers to make themselves look even
more clueless than they already do, while subtly conveying to the more savvy
and experienced that it is in fact a deliberate troll. If you don't fall for
the joke, you get to be in on it.

2. n. An individual who chronically trolls in sense 1; regularly posts
specious arguments, flames or personal attacks to a newsgroup, discussion
list, or in email for no other purpose than to annoy someone or disrupt a
discussion. Trolls are recognizable by the fact that they have no real
interest in learning about the topic at hand - they simply want to utter
flame bait. Like the ugly creatures they are named after, they exhibit no
redeeming characteristics, and as such, they are recognized as a lower form
of life on the net, as in, "Oh, ignore him, he's just a troll."

Above is reprint text extract from answers.com

On Sun, 24 Sep 2006 22:00:06 -0700, yvonne scholl wrote:

what is a troll?


Somebody who posts articles which are inflamatory, just to watch the
flames which spring up.

what is a kill file?


A filter which can trigger on specific message characteristics, and
mark, hide, or delete unwanted articles. Often used to filter messages
by trolls, in order to avoid reading the, mostly useless, thread
resulting from troll feeding.

And troll feeding is responding to troll posts. Am I doing that with
you? Some here appear to think so; but I will just be naive, and assume
that you are just naive.
